Injury: Any type of injury to the lung, especially chronic, such as bacterial infections, abscess, trauma, can cause scarring.

Lung scars: If damage to your lungs injures the lungs to the point of cell death, then the body will heal by making a scar. Scars do not function well for breathing. Fortunately we have lung reserves. However, if enough lung tissue is scarred then oxygen may be required. If still more damage is done a lung transplant will be necessary.
